When assessing registered agent offerings, comprehending the costs involved is crucial for organizations of different scales. The fees for engaging a registered agent can differ significantly based on the company and the scope of features offered. Typically, you can expect to pay anywhere from 50 to 300 dollars annually for expert registered agent services. Some affordable registered agent providers even offer packages starting at just a small amount a month, attracting new businesses and small businesses aiming to minimize costs. It's crucial to evaluate the included services to ensure that you're getting good value for your investment.
In addition to the yearly fee, there may be additional costs related with certain services such as mail handling, filing services, and compliance notifications. For case in point, if your registered agent supplies annual compliance reminders or handles legal documents, these may incur extra charges. Keep in mind that some registered agent providers offer comprehensive service packages that group multiple offerings, which can lead to savings in the long run, making your organization registered agent costs more manageable.
It is also important to consider potential recurring fees and any costs associated with switching your registered agent, should you need to modify services in the coming time. Many registered agents provide clear-cut processes for altering registered agents, but they might charge a fee for the administrative tasks involved. Modifying one's registered agent is a straightforward process, yet it is important to follow the right steps to ensure adherence with state guidelines. The initial step is to select a different registered agent provider that satisfies one's business demands. Take into account aspects such as dependability, pricing, and the services they offer, including registered agent solutions and compliance management. After you have selected a new agent, you should review the registered agent requirements particular to one's state, as they can change.
Next, you will need to fill out the appropriate forms to officially change your registered agent. This typically entails filing a registered agent change form to the state agency responsible for business registrations. Ensure that all details is accurate and complete to prevent any delays. Some states may ask you to obtain permission from your different registered agent, so be sure to verify that they are prepared and capable to take on this duty.
Finally, after your application is accepted, you should revise one's records to reflect the modification. This involves notifying your old registered agent and ensuring that any legal documents or service of process are sent to your different registered agent.
